Abstract :
A blind print-scan (PS) resilient watermarking scheme is proposed in this paper. By employing a series of novel solutions in block classification and different block-based embedding strategies, we achieved a good performance in terms of watermark capacity, robustness and image quality. The experimental results further demonstrate the validity of our proposed scheme.
